One of the greatest high school basketball players to ever play in New York City , there was no way Bill Rieser wasn't going to make it in the NBA He could do things on a
basketball court no one else could--and that's why they called him 'White Jesus.' But after a serious knee injury and clashes with his college coach derailed his career, Bill
descended into a self-destructive lifestyle of drinking, drug abuse, and womanizing. He was going to be just another washed-up playground legend--until he encountered Jesus Christ and
became something far more.
